If you've selected concrete for your driveway or car park, you've made a wonderful selection! Concrete is long lasting, functional and also reduced maintenance. However, having a top quality output includes greater than simply choosing the appropriate materialyou additionally require the appropriate service provider to perform the job. But exactly how do you pick one? The primary step to success is to locate a perfect concrete specialist for the job you desire done.

We'll offer a couple of pointers for discovering a service provider, as well as after that we'll experience inquiries to ask when discussing your project. Looking up regional concrete specialists in the phone book or by means of a web search can raise a lengthy checklist of companies to learn. Patios. A good option is to ask family and also pals for the names of contractors who have actually done terrific job for them on similar tasks.



When you have a list of service providers, get in touch with each to ask for a price quote or quote for the job. (Focus on their feedback times!) Some might merely offer you a square-foot cost array over the phone or e-mail, and others will want to go to the website to offer you a much more precise quote.

Inspecting the Better Organization Bureau is an additional method to veterinarian a professional. Using a service provider accredited by the American Concrete Institute (ACI) indicates your job will certainly satisfy specific needs to make it durable and also strong.

For sidewalk projects, search for a contractor who has received ACI certification in concrete flatwork. You can most likely to to seek out an individual's accreditation condition. If you're looking to add an ornamental touch to your task, ask the professional about their credentials for ornamental concrete. You also ought to ask service providers to give recommendations and examples of their workspecifically for tasks similar to yours. Quality professionals take satisfaction in their work as well as rejoice to provide images as well as endorsements from satisfied consumers. A specialist that can not generate photo proof of their work or is reluctant to use contact info for previous customers is a red flag.

There might be situations in which a contractor may ask for a tiny earnest deposit prior to placement to safeguard your project in their routine. Constantly ask the service provider to give evidence of their repayment to the ready-mix concrete provider (https://slashdot.org/submission/17192677/local-concrete-contractors-chicago). This is a crucial demand because an unpaid concrete producer can place a lien on your property till the repayment has been completed.

Good specialists are often in need and have active routines. While they need to be able to complete little concrete tasks, like driveways, in two to three days, it will take longerpossibly a week or twoto complete more extensive tasks, such as car park, sidewalks around big, multifamily domestic buildings and also so forth.

The concrete service provider needs to be educated concerning the allowing process as well as what allows may be needed for your task. It never hurts to ask the contractor what licenses he requires to obtain so you understand the procedure. Make certain both you and the service provider recognize the distinctions in between concrete overlays and also tasks needing overall elimination as well as replacement of the existing pavementand exactly how much building waste each commonly creates.

Unfortunately, lots of property concrete specialists do not properly treat the concrete immediately after it is placed. The good news is, concrete is forgiving and oftentimes does not show any kind of damage as a result of this. Fresh concrete undergoes a chemical procedure during which it sets (sets), generally reaching a factor where it's safe for typical foot web traffic 24 to 2 days after positioning and after that reaching complete stamina at 28 days.

This is done by maintaining the surface area wet and also at the appropriate temperature level (50-85 degrees Fahrenheit) throughout the initial week or so after concrete is put, and they must use approaches to preserve optimal treating conditions during warm, chilly, dry or windy weather condition. Applying a sealer to a concrete slab isn't a necessity, yet it will certainly improve the concrete surface area's appearance and also make it much easier to preserve. A sealer also may aid enhance the long life of the concrete, specifically if you intend on using salt to deice your sidewalk.
